LORD'S SUPPER
11 a.m. Worship Service
Please note that we will observe the Lord's Supper this Sunday. The Westminster Shorter Catechism speaks to how we ought to prepare ourselves for this sacrament. It says, "It is required of them that would worthily partake of the Lord's supper, that they examine themselves of their knowledge to discern the Lord's body, of their faith to feed upon him, of their repentance, love, and new obedience, lest, coming unworthily, they eat and drink judgment to themselves." Please take time to prepare.
